ATTENTION: Clipper card and account information may not be visible on the mobile app and website right now. If you need to add value to your Clipper card and are unable to, we encourage you to pay your fare with a plastic or mobile contactless bank card. The Clipper Customer Service Center is unable to provide account services over the phone at this time, but customers can instead email custserv@clippercard.com. We apologize for the inconvenience.

From day one of this administration, I’ve said that safe and clean streets are my top priority. If people do not feel safe moving through our streets—whether they are walking, biking, taking transit, or driving—then we are not meeting that goal. We launched the Street Safety Initiative last year, a citywide effort that brings departments together to address traffic safety. Today the working group met to continue this work so we can build a city where people feel safe moving through their neighborhoods every day. Thank you to Supervisor Myrna Melgar and our city departments for helping lead this discussion.
